Six policemen test Covid +ve

RANCHI: Entry of common people to Ranchi’s five police stations -Argora, Bariatu, Dhurwa, Hindpiri and Chutia -- has been prohibited after six personnel from these stations found infected with Coronaviru­s on Friday. The police personnel, who came in contact with infected persons, also undergone a medical check-up on Sunday, the police said.

Those who are coming with complaints have to submit their applicatio­ns at outer gate of the police stations or drop box. The arrangemen­t was made so that routine works at the police stations does not hamper.

“We have stopped entry of the people inside the five police stations for now. We are drafting a viable SOP (standard operating procedure) in this regard and it will come into effect in a day or two,” said superinten­dent of police (City), Saurabh.

When asked if these police stations will be sealed or declared containmen­t zone, the city SP said, “I don’t think declaring police stations as containmen­t zones is required. It is declared to a public place where people stay.”

He said they have traced out all the persons who came in contact with infected persons. “If they turned negative, what is the point to declare them (police stations) as containmen­t zone,” he said.

He said the medical checkup of police personnel at Bariatu police station has come to an end. “The exercise is on in other four stations and it will be completed by today itself,” he said. He added the police stations are also being sanitized.

State health department on Sunday conducted a medical checkup and took swab samples of police personnel from five police stations, who had come in contact with the infected persons.

“The police department after contact tracing had handed over a list of around 200 people, mostly police personnel, for medical check-up. We are taking swab of all the people mentioned in the list from five police stations,” said Ranchi civil surgeon VB Prasad.
